0.0.1

A coding agent for your terminal

The first release of e runs on macOS and Linux. Connect a hosted or local model, work in a repository, and save conversations you can resume or branch later.

New features

  • Use hosted or local models, with supported subscription sign-in and API keys.
  • Resume conversations, branch from earlier prompts, and steer an active turn with another message.
  • Attach images, inspect full tool output with Ctrl+O, and run shell commands from the composer with !.
  • Customize instructions, prompt templates, skills, themes, and keybindings under ~/.e/.
  • Add tools, commands, and hooks through executable extensions. Use JSONL RPC for automation.
  • Install checksum-verified binaries for ARM64 and x86-64, and update with e update.

Improvements

  • Tool calls show live output, outcome counts, and edit statistics. Full write content stays in the tool-output reader.
  • Markdown supports highlighted code, tables, task lists, and terminal links. The composer wraps drafts and collapses large pastes.
  • Provider retries explain the cause and wait time. Quota and billing failures stop without retrying.

Fixes

  • Resuming a session follows the selected branch and retains interrupted replies. Torn final records can be recovered.
  • Shell commands enforce timeouts and stop their process groups. Edits reject stale file observations.
  • Extension crashes cannot leave calls waiting indefinitely, and exit paths restore terminal modes.
  • Security: model output and extension notices cannot inject terminal controls. Diagnostics omit credentials, and pasted API keys stay out of prompt history.
